Yasargil Ligature Guide

Yasargil Ligature Guide is a specialized device that neurosurgeons commonly use to engage and convey suture threads across the surgical field, in order to perform ligature of blood vessels or other soft tissues.

The Yasargil Ligature Guide offers a wide assortment of surgical advantages. Its principal use is to navigate sutures with ease, permitting surgeons to ligate the thread around vessels and prevent haemorrhage.

For this purpose, the instrument features a ball-ended tip that allows for accommodating the thread with precision. In addition, the working end varies in different patterns that feature narrow and deep curves. Surgeons can pick the pattern according to the suture to manipulate and the anatomical surgical area.

Moreover, the Yasargil Ligature Guide has an ergonomically designed solid handle that enhances gripping. Also, the knurled grip style pattern that covers the handle’s surface reduces the risk of slippage.

Manufactured in premium grade stainless steel to ensure the highest quality instruments in your operating rooms.
